Biological Robots or Xenobots

These tiny and programmable organisms are made from frog cells. Xenobots can self-heal, move, and even replicate in an ethical manner.

3D Bioprinting

3D Bioprinting is about printing human organs and tissues. It utilises human cells and bio-ink to print skin, bladders, and other body parts. Some artificial organs, including some heart assist devices and bladders, are already in use for clinical trials.

AI-Powered Diagnostics

AI to diagnose diseases with greater accuracy and analyse reports to minimise probable human errors. AI-powered diagnostics make the process faster and more accurate, and can find patterns that a human doctor might miss.

Artificial Womb

It mimics a natural womb. An artificial womb allows premature fetuses to grow further by providing nutrients through the umbilical cord.

Scientists use gene editing to correct genetic defects, providing the potential cure for genetic diseases like sickle cell anaemia, and to modify other organisms.

CAR-T Cell Therapy

A landmark therapy for cancer treatment. In this method, a patient’s own T cells target and attack cancer cells with remarkable precision.

Exoskeletons

These Robotics Suits help people with mobility issues due to age and health conditions. It improves endurance and strength, enabling workers to lift heavy loads.

Synthetic Biology

It includes designing and developing new biological parts, systems, and organisms to build plant-based meat options, biofuels, and other products.

How does a BTech in Biotechnology and Bioengineering differ from a BSc?

A BTech usually emphasises engineering, systems design, and scale-up (bioreactors, instrumentation), while a BSc focuses on foundational biology and lab research; both are complementary paths into biotech careers.
